You will provide optimal patient care for all patients at St John of God Berwick their families and significant others. This care will be provided in collaboration with all members of the health care team including medical practitioners and allied health practitioners. This care will be guided by a working knowledge of hospital policies including OH&S Infection Control Waste Management and Quality Improvement.
We are currently seeking Casual Enrolled Nurses to support increasing demand across our Medical Surgical and Rehabilitation Units. Flexibility to work regularly across different shifts and days to assist us in meet the changing staffing needs of the hospital will be essential for this role.
The Position
Function within the legal and registration constraint relevant to your Enrolled Nursing Practice
Collaborate with the healthcare team to develop and implement care plans
Maintain and develop clinical skills required to deliver high quality holistic patient care
Adhere to and supports hospital policies procedures and standards
To monitor patient progress and escalate any changes or concerns to a registered nurse or manager
Provides patient education and participates in discharge planning as required
Accurately document patient care
You will have current Registration with the Nursing and Midwifery Board of Australia (AHPRA) as an Enrolled Nurse and a minimum of 12 months recent experience in general medical and/or surgical nursing roles. Strong interpersonal and communication skills to support effective teamwork will be essential to this position.
To succeed you will have an understanding of legislation and standards related to OH&S Infection Control Waste Management and Quality Improvement and clinical practice in a relevant environment. You will also demonstrate a commitment to ongoing professional development and desire to continuously improve your nursing practice
Above all patient care will be at the core of everything you do committing to and supporting our mission and values.
